The Deepest Blues Are Black - Foo Fighters

The 9th Track off of Foo fighters In Your Honour Album. In Your Honor is the fifth album by the Foo Fighters, released on June 14, 2005. It is the band's second best selling album behind 1997's The Colour and the Shape. It consists of two discs. All of the tracks on the second disc are acoustic. Much of the album's theme and content came after Grohl spent time on the campaign trail with John Kerry during the 2004 presidential election. "We'd pull in to small towns, and thousands of people would come to be rescued by this man," said Grohl. "It's not a political record, but what I saw inspired me."[1] Dave Grohl has stated that the song, "Friend of a Friend", was written about himself and his former Nirvana bandmates Kurt Cobain and Krist Novoselic during the time they shared an apartment together in 1990. Contrary to the sombre tone of the song, it was written before Cobain's death in 1994.[2] In Your Honor features a number of special guests on its second, mellower disc, such as, for example, Norah Jones, John Paul Jones (of Led Zeppelin fame) and Josh Homme of Queens of the Stone Age. Dave Grohl has described John Paul Jones' guest appearance as the "second greatest thing to happen to me in my life." On an episode of Making the Video on MTV, for the single "Best of You", Grohl said that he hopes that the Foo Fighters are most remembered for this album.
